Processor

Processor Class: Intel Core 2 Duo Mobile

Processor Speed: 2.26 GHz

Cache Size: 3 MB

Bus Speed: 1066 MHz

Memory

Installed Memory: 2 GB

Maximum Memory: 8 GB

Memory Technology: DDR3

System

Input Devices: Keyboard, Touchpad, TrackPoint

Interface Connection: Audio - Line In (1/8" Mini), Audio - Line Out (1/8" Mini), Ethernet - RJ45, FireWire 400/IEEE 1394 - 4 pin, Port Replicator/Docking Station, Serial - RJ11 (Phone Jack), USB - Universal Serial Bus 2.0, VGA

Slots: Express Card 34, Express Card 54, Type I PC Card, Type II PC Card

Display

Display Size: 14.1 in

Aspect Ratio: 16:10

Display Type: LCD Display w/ Glossy Screen

Max Resolution: 1280 x 800

Video Chipset: Intel Graphics Media Accelerator 4500 MHD

Storage

Included Drives: CD-RW/DVD-ROM

Hard Drive Capacity: 250 GB

Number of Hard Drives Included: 1

Features

Included Network Card: Ethernet (10/100/1000 Mbps), Wireless Ethernet - IEEE802.11 Draft N, Wireless Ethernet - IEEE802.11a, Wireless Ethernet - IEEE802.11b, Wireless Ethernet - IEEE802.11g

Battery Life: 3.6 hour(s)

Green Compliance: Yes

Software

Operating System: Microsoft Windows Vista Home Basic

Dimensions

Height: 1.36 in

Width: 13.2 in

Depth: 9.28 in

Weight: 5.34 lbs

Excellent laptop hammered by a terrible LCD

Strengths: Keyboard/peripherals, Weight, Durability, Build Quality

Weakness: Display performance

This laptop has the best keyboard in class, built like a tank and overall is head and shoulders above competition. But there is one huge "but": Lenovo uses absolutely the worst LCDs. I have tried LED and CCFL versions and the deal is always the same: terrible colors, extremely low contrast, light bleed and practically ZERO viewing angle - the bottom of the screen is like 30% brighter than the...

Lenovo ThinkPad T400 | P8400 - 2GB RAM - 250GB HDD - Vista Home Basic

Evolving out of the 14" T61, the T400 is a standard business-class laptop from Lenovo. Built to be fast and full featured the T Series is based on the new Centrino 2 platform, containing the latest 45nm Intel Core 2 Duos, DDR3 ram and the new the new Intel X4500HD integrated graphics chip.
